Craig Slater is a 31-year-old football player who plays as a central midfielder for Forfar Athletic, born on 26 أبريل 1994, who is right-footed. In the 2025/2026 League Two season, Craig Slater has recorded 2 goals, 3 assists, 1,562 minutes, 7 yellow cards.

Craig Slater scores highly on Goals, Assists, and Minutes compared to central midfielders in the League Two.

Craig Slater's career has also included time at Arbroath, Forfar Athletic, Queen's Park, Partick Thistle, Colchester United, Dundee United, and Kilmarnock.

On the international stage, Craig Slater has represented Scotland U21 and Scotland U17.

Throughout their career, Craig Slater has won 1 title: League Two (2020/2021) with Queen's Park.
